Two Victims Identified in Brown University Shooting as Police Persist in Search for Perpetrator.
Both young individuals who lost their lives in the recent mass shooting on the university campus had tributes paid to them on Monday – as a manhunt for their killer carried on following the discharge by local law enforcement of the sole person questioned in the case.

Details of the Attack
Nine other people were injured in the weekend shooting in the school of engineering of Brown’s campus in Providence, during the university's examination week.
Law enforcement reported late Sunday that a 24-year-old male detained in a search at a Hampton Inn about around 27 kilometers from the scene earlier in the day was being released.
“We have a murderer out there,” stated the state's top prosecutor, Peter Neronha.
Neronha explained, “Occasionally a probe goes down a path, and then you have to regroup and go in another, and this is precisely what occurred over the last day or so.”

The Wounded Victims
Of the nine hurt, one pupil was released from the hospital, said Brown’s president, Christina Paxson. Seven more were in critical but stable condition, and one remained in critical care, authorities stated on Sunday.
